1. Data Interpretation

Water quality tests yield numerical values or qualitative observations. For example, a pH

reading of 7 indicates neutrality, while values below 7 suggest acidity. The answer key

typically provides expected ranges or thresholds for healthy water bodies. Understanding

why certain readings are considered normal or problematic is essential.

2. Correlating Parameters

Water parameters don’t exist in isolation. High nitrate levels can lead to algal blooms,

which in turn reduce dissolved oxygen. The answer key often explains these correlations,

helping students see the bigger picture of ecosystem dynamics.

Key Components of Water Quality in the Virtual Lab

To excel in interpreting the assessing water quality virtual lab answer key, it helps to

understand the common parameters tested in these labs:

pH Level: Measures the acidity or alkalinity of water. Healthy aquatic life usually

1.

thrives in a pH range of 6.5 to 8.5.

Dissolved Oxygen (DO): Indicates the amount of oxygen available for aquatic

2.

organisms. Low DO levels can be a sign of pollution or eutrophication.

Turbidity: Measures water clarity. High turbidity can reduce sunlight penetration,

3.

affecting photosynthesis in aquatic plants.

Nitrate and Phosphate Levels: Nutrients that in excess can cause harmful algal

4.

blooms.

Temperature: Influences chemical reactions and organism metabolism in the

5.

water.

The answer key provides benchmarks for these components, which help users determine

whether the water sample is healthy or compromised.
